I'm a huge fan of the base16 color schemes - not for their appearance (though most look great), but for their ease of integration within the shell and vim. Just clone the repos below, drop a few lines in your shellrc/vimrc, then use a single bash command to change the scheme in both. No mucking more mucking with Xresources. https://github.com/chriskempson/base16-shell https://github.com/chriskempson/base16-vim. - Source: Hacker News / about 2 years ago
